Definition: an unscramble is the act of rearranging a jumbled set of letters back into valid dictionary words. Unlike a simple anagram (which must use every letter exactly once), unscrambling also finds every shorter sub-word that can be built from a subset of those letters.

How We Calculated These Words
Every candidate above was looked up by its alphabetical signature— the letters of the word sorted into A–Z order. Two words share a signature if and only if they contain the same letters, which is what makes anagram and sub-anagram lookups instant instead of O(n!). We then subtract each candidate's per-letter counts from your input's counts, drawing on the wildcard pool for any deficit, so only words you actually have the tiles to spell are returned.
